Java后端】@DateTimeFormat @JsonFormat 时间格式传参总结1. 前言最近在时间Date传参时,没有加注解、前端多种格式都可以接收到数据,从而总结一下其中原因。2. 介绍2.1 无注解在Spring Boot 2.x中,当前端通过POST请求发送一个时间字符串"2023-06-20 21:04:50"时,后端使用Date类型来接收,并且没有标注任何注解,仍然可以接收到
java常用数据类型之date类型详解实例介绍。java.util.Date是我们经常要使用到日期类数据类型,由此可见,我们应该多点了解这方面的知识,例如Date类基本面用法、Date类方法,Date类型对象构造方法等。java api里面日期类型继承关系如下:java.lang.Object–java.util.Date–java.sql.Date–java.sql.Time–jav
转载 2023-06-03 15:04:19
234阅读
1.SimpleDateFormat​是对日期Date类对格式化和解析 2.两个操作 (1)格式化:日期—>字符串 (2)解析:格式化对逆过程,字符串—>日期
转载 2023-07-21 20:38:09
171阅读
Java中,DateTime是一个用于处理日期和时间类。它提供了一系列方法来操作和计算日期和时间,非常方便实用。下面我将指导你如何在Java中使用DateTime。 首先,让我们来看看整个流程。我将使用表格展示详细步骤。 | 步骤 | 描述 | | --- | --- | | 步骤一 | 导入所需日期时间类 | | 步骤二 | 创建一个DateTime对象 | | 步骤三 | 使用Da
原创 2024-01-09 09:37:43
70阅读
1.java.util.Date 日期类  构造函数  Date() 表示当前时间     Date(int ,int ,int) 填入年月日,年份需减去1900,月份为0-11     Date(int,int,int,int,int,int)年月日时分秒  主要方法:   after(
转载 2023-08-18 10:08:38
198阅读
一、获取系统当前时间想获取系统当前时间,System类中静态方法currentTimeMillis()想必大家都不会陌生,它返回是当前时间与1970年1月1日0时0分0秒之间以毫秒为单位时间差,也被称为时间戳。二、java.util.Date类与java.sql.Date类关于这两个类,很多人可能不是特别清楚两者之间区别与联系,接下来我们对此进行简单梳理。区别:首先,从包名可以看出jav
转载 2023-08-16 18:28:33
120阅读
java.util.Date是Java中用于表示日期和时间类,它表示是一个特定瞬间(精确到千分之一秒级别),即从1970年1月1日00:00:00 GMT(格林尼治标准时间)开始计时微秒数。下面是java.util.Date类中常用方法:      1.Date(): 构造一个表示当前日期和时间Date对象。Date now = new Date(); S
转载 2024-03-04 06:31:20
43阅读
作者:何甜甜在吗 通过阅读本篇文章你将了解到:为什么需要 LocalDate、 LocalTime、 LocalDateTime【java8新提供类】java8新时间 API使用方式,包括创建、格式化、解析、计算、修改为什么需要LocalDate、LocalTime、LocalDateTimeDate如果不格式化,打印出日期可读性差 使用 SimpleDateForm
转载 2024-07-04 17:42:16
30阅读
java 常用时间工具类• java.util.Calender • java.util.Date 是用于表示一个日期和时间对象(实际一个long类型以毫秒表示时间戳) • java.time.LocalDateTime • java.time.LocalDate • java.time.ZonedDateTime • java.time.Instant初始化操作及具体时间指定:data
转载 2023-08-16 16:49:26
108阅读
# 解析Javadatetime类型无法获取MySQLdatetime类型Java中,我们经常会使用`java.time.LocalDateTime`来表示日期和时间。然而,当我们需要将这种类型映射到MySQL数据库中`datetime`类型时,会发现存在一些问题。 ## 问题描述 Java`LocalDateTime`类型是一个不可变日期-时间对象,其中包含了日期和时间,
原创 2024-06-25 06:34:37
236阅读
# 如何在Java中使用datetime类型获取MySQLdatetime类型 ## 引言 在开发中,我们经常会遇到需要在Java中使用datetime类型来获取MySQL数据库中datetime类型情况。这可能会导致一些困惑,特别是对于刚入行开发者。在本文中,我将向你展示如何实现这一过程,并帮助你解决这个问题。 ## 整体流程 首先,让我们通过一个表格展示整个过程步骤: | 步骤
原创 2024-07-01 04:11:55
57阅读
# 实现Java DateTime类型 ## 简介 在Java中,DateTime类型可以用来表示日期和时间。它提供了一系列方法来操作日期和时间,并且支持时区转换和格式化。本文将向你介绍如何实现Java DateTime类型。 ## 步骤 下面是实现Java DateTime类型步骤: | 步骤 | 描述 | | --- | --- | | 1 | 导入必要类库 | | 2 | 创建一
原创 2023-08-06 13:08:47
962阅读
# Javadatetime类型定义与应用 在软件开发中,处理日期和时间是非常常见需求。Java语言提供了多种处理日期和时间方式,其中datetime类型就是一种常用方式。datetime类型可以表示一个精确时间点,并可以方便地进行日期和时间计算、比较等操作。本文将介绍Javadatetime类型定义和应用,并提供相关代码示例。 ## 1. Javadatetime类型
原创 2024-04-27 05:10:49
210阅读
# 工作流程:将MySQLDATETIME类型Java相结合 ## 引言 在开发过程中,处理数据库时间戳是非常常见需求。MySQL提供了DATETIME类型来存储日期和时间,而Java则有一系列日期时间类来处理这样数据。本文将带你一步一步地实现如何在Java中使用MySQLDATETIME类型。 ## 整体流程 下面是实现这一功能步骤: | 步骤 | 描述
原创 9月前
24阅读
 Date和Calendar是Java类库里提供对时间进行处理类,由于日期在商业逻辑应用中占据着很重要地位,所以在这里想对这两个类进行一个基本讲解,由于技术有限,不到之处请指正。 Date类顾名思义,一看就知道是和日期有关类了,这个类最主要作用就是获得当前时间了,然而这个类里面也具有设置时间以及一些其他功能,可是由于本身设计问题,这些方法却遭到众多批评,而这些遭受批评
转载 9月前
7阅读
# JavaDateTime类型 ## 引言 在Java开发中,经常需要处理日期和时间。Java 8之前,我们使用是`java.util.Date`和`java.util.Calendar`类来处理日期和时间。然而,这些类存在一些问题,比如可变性、线程安全性、不一致性等。Java 8为我们引入了新日期和时间API,其中最重要类是`java.time`包下`LocalDateTime`
原创 2023-09-24 02:01:51
214阅读
在使用 MyBatis 查询 MySQL `DATETIME` 类型时,有时会遇到一些想当然会失败问题。接下来,我将详细记录“mybatis 如何查询出mysql datetime类型”这个问题分析和解决过程,帮助大家更好地理解这个过程。 ## 问题背景 当一个团队正在开发一个新业务模块时,开发人员试图通过 MyBatis 从 MySQL 数据库中获取存储为 `DATETIME`
原创 6月前
160阅读
    A、有时候在网站注册账号时,会有日期选项,下面会有一个小型日历可供选择。这个日期其实是个String类, 选择了日期之后,这个String类会通过程序,转换为Date类,再存入数据库中。   B、反之,这个小型日历形成,也是从数据库中提取出Date类,再通过程序转换为String类显示出来。   而A中过程,其实就是 String -- Date(解析)     publi
# Java Date类型Datetime类型实现 ## 1. 概述 在Java中,日期和时间处理是非常常见需求。为了满足这一需求,Java提供了两种不同日期和时间类型:Date类型Datetime类型。这两种类型主要区别是精度不同:Date类型精确到毫秒级别,而Datetime类型精确到纳秒级别。 在本文中,我将向您介绍如何在Java中实现这两种日期和时间类型,并通过表格和
原创 2023-09-17 09:17:38
470阅读
时间主要分为3个模块:  time模块,datetime模块,calendar模块1、time模块 和 datetime模块import time, datetime #获取当前时间,并把它转换为字符串 # 方法一: >>> time <module 'time' (built-in)> >>> type(time) <class 'modul
  • 1
  • 2
  • 3
  • 4
  • 5